More DescriptionProgressive key relationships are of little value to the beginner in the opinion of the author. Much more important is the left-hand relationship to the finger-board and its adaptation. This approach has been chosen for the Methods because of its simplicity and practicability. Necessary theoretical material has been scattered throughout the volumes as new principles are introduced. Basic mechanical principles of playing must be maintained by proper postures but the postures may vary depending upon the difference in size of hands and arms of individuals.
This volume contains a new approach to the study of positions based upon relative finger and interval distance: also change of positions is introduced on each of the four strings within the octave range, taking the student up to the 7th position. The keys of B, F#, Db, and Gb Major, G#, D#, Bb, and Eb, Minor are presented with one-octave scales and arpeggiated chords founded upon the Tonic, Submediant and Subdominant of each instance. Melodic technical material, in these keys as well as original and attractive short pieces with a second violin part, are given. The principles of rhythm and the primary bowings, together with theoretical explanations, are scattered throughout the work.
